    摘要: A hand-held power tool has a tool member and a motor drivingly connected to the tool member, wherein the motor is arranged in a motor housing. A battery for driving the tool member is provided. A guide shaft has arranged on its first end the battery and on its second end the motor housing and the tool member. A rotatably power output part arranged on the motor housing is drivingly connected to the motor. The power output part supports the tool member. Cooling air is sucked through the guide shaft into the motor housing. Between the power output part and the motor housing an annular air exit gap is formed through which the cooling air exits the motor housing. At least one guide vane that projects into the annular air exit gap is provided.

    摘要: A hand-held electric device has a device housing with a battery pack compartment. A battery pack is disposed in the battery pack compartment. The battery pack compartment has guide elements extending in the insertion direction of the battery pack. The battery pack has a battery pack housing and guide sections provided on the battery pack housing that interact with the guide elements. The battery pack has an electric connector head disposed on the battery pack housing. The battery pack compartment has contact elements. In a predetermined insertion position of the battery pack in the battery pack compartment the contact elements electrically contact the connector head. A contact plate is floatingly supported in the battery pack compartment and the contact elements are disposed on the contact plate.

    摘要: An exchangeable battery pack for an electric device has a housing with a first end face and a second end face opposite the first end face, wherein the first end is open. A housing cover closes off the first end face. Battery cells are disposed in the housing. Cell connectors electrically connect the cells with one another. An external electrical connector is disposed on the second end face. All of the battery cells are connected to the external electrical connector. The battery cells are charged and discharged through the external electrical connector. A cell holder secures several of the battery cells. An inner positional securing element is provided on an inner side of a sidewall of the housing and the cell holder interacts with the positional securing element.

    摘要: An electric power tool has a device housing with a rear grip extending in the longitudinal direction of the device housing. The device housing has first opposed housing sides and second opposed housing sides. An electric drive motor and its electronic control are arranged in the device housing. A battery pack compartment arranged in the device housing receives a battery pack that has a parallelepipedal shape and extends in a direction of a height axis, width axis and depth axis. The battery pack is arranged such that the width axis and the height axis extend transversely to the longitudinal axis of the device housing. The battery pack has narrow sides extending approximately parallel and at a minimal spacing relative to the first opposed housing sides, respectively. The battery pack has opposed end faces neighboring the second housing sides, respectively.

    摘要: A method for operating an internal combustion engine having a fuel system which feeds fuel at a given pressure to a metering valve provides that a controller defines the opening time and the closing time of the metering valve and correspondingly actuates the metering valve so that the metering valve opens and closes at the defined times. In order to permit precise metering of fuel even in high-speed internal combustion engines there is provision for the controller to define at least one of the times for the opening or closing of the metering valve while taking into account the counterpressure actually prevailing at the outlet opening of the metering valve.
